The Juventus Men's First Team face Sassuolo away from home on Serie A Matchday 19, soon after the draw against Lecce.

Sassuolo sit mid-table in Serie A after a positive start to the season.

Let’s get up to speed ahead of Tuesday evening’s 20:45 CET kick-off.

Interesting Facts

  • Juventus is the team against which Sassuolo has lost the most matches in Serie A: 15 wins for the Bianconeri, with three draws and four wins for the Neroverdi.
  • The last six matches between Sassuolo and Juventus in the league have been perfectly balanced: three wins each, after the Neroverdi had earned only two points in the previous 11 matches between the two teams in Serie A.
  • The most frequent score between Sassuolo and Juventus in Serie A is 3-1 in favour of the Bianconeri, the final score in five matches, the most recent of which was on 12 May 2021.
  • Juventus are unbeaten in their last six Serie A matches played on Epiphany (4W, 2D), conceding only three goals in this period and recording three clean sheets; their last defeat on 6 January in the league dates back to 2013, a 2-1 home defeat.
  • Since his first season in Serie A (2020/21), Weston McKennie is one of only two Juventus players, after scoring in the last matchday, to have found the net in five different seasons (along with Dusan Vlahovic).
  • Manuel Locatelli is one of only two players with at least 1,000 successful passes in this Serie A season: 1,078, behind only Luka Modrić (1,082).

Opposition Focus

  • Since arriving at Sassuolo in 2022/23, Kristian Thorstvedt - who scored in the 1-1 draw against Parma in the last round - is one of only four foreign midfielders with more than 15 goals scored between Serie A and Serie B: 17 (10 in the top flight, seven in the second division).
  • Jay Idzes' only goal in Serie A was against Juventus on 14 December 2024 while playing for Venezia (the match ended 2-2).
  • Armand Laurienté, who has won two of his three matches against Juventus in Serie A, both played at home, has already scored a goal against the Bianconeri before, on 23 September 2023.
  • Sassuolo have won both of their last two league matches against Juventus at the MAPEI Stadium, after picking up just five points (1W, 2D, 6L) in their first nine home games against the Bianconeri in Serie A. Only against Crotone (three) do the Emiliani have a longer current run of consecutive home wins in Serie A.
  • Juventus have scored at least two goals in eight away games against Sassuolo in Serie A. No team has done better against the Neroverdi: Milan, Napoli and Roma have also scored at least two goals in eight away games.
  • Tarik Muharemovic is the Sassuolo player with the most defensive clearances (105) and blocked shots (13) in the current Serie A season and also the Neroverde player with the most interceptions (24) in this championship.
